在Vue项目中配置Access-Control-Allow-Origin实际上并不是在前端Vue代码中直接设置的,而是需要在服务器端进行配置。这是因为Access-Control-Allow-Origin是一个HTTP响应头,用于指示哪些源可以访问资源,而这部分配置是由服务器来控制的。以下是在不同服务器端配置Access-Control-Allow-Origin的几种
这个值也只能设为true。如果要发送Cookie,Access-Control-Allow-Origin必须设置为必须指定明确的、与请求网页一致的域名 Access-Control-Expose-Headers:可选。CORS请求时,XMLHttpRequest对象的getResponseHeader()方法只能拿到6个基本字段:Cache-Control、Content-Language、Content-Type、Expires、Last-Modified、Pragma。如果...
服务器端设置:在服务器端设置Access-Control-Allow-Origin头部。 代理服务器:在开发环境中,可以使用代理服务器来绕过同源策略。 代理服务器:在开发环境中,可以使用代理服务器来绕过同源策略。 JSONP:一种老旧的技术,只适用于 GET 请求,且需要服务器支持。
Access Control Allow Origin是一个HTTP响应头,用来告诉浏览器当前请求是否允许跨域访问。当服务器收到一个跨域请求时,会检查请求头中的Origin字段,然后根据设置的Access Control Allow Origin来决定是否允许跨域访问。 在Vue中设置Axios跨域请求 首先,我们需要安装Axios和VueAxios依赖: npm install axios vue-axios 1. ...
proxy: { ["/dev-api"]:{ target:'http://127.0.0.1:5000', changeOrigin:true, pathRewrite: { ['^' + "/dev-ap"]: ''} } }, after: require('./mock/mock-server.js') }, 查询时的url设置成'/teacher/edit'就好了,不需要添加/dev-api,在pathRewrite中已经抵消了 ...
{// 匹配所有以 '/api2'开头的请求路径target: 'http://localhost:5001',// 代理目标的基础路径changeOrigin: true,pathRewrite: {'^/api2': ''}}}/*changeOrigin设置为true时,服务器收到的请求头中的host为:localhost:5000changeOrigin设置为false时,服务器收到的请求头中的host为:localhost:8080changeOrigin...
此问题是由跨域导致的:No 'Access-Control-Allow-Origin' header is present on the requested resource。如果你的前端应用和后端 API 服务器没有运行在同一个主机上,你需要在开发环境下将 API 请求代理到 API 服务器。 解决方案 简介 可以通过 vue.config.js 中的 devServer.proxy 选项来配置。devServer.proxy...
Vue CLI3 解决access-control-allow-origin 工具/原料 Vue CLI3 方法/步骤 1 1.实现引入axios的方法代码 2 2.实现在src/axios/目录下创建index.js的方法代码 3 3.实现在main.js中引入axios的方法代码 4 4.实现修改login.vue--》在login方法中发送ajax请求的方法代码 5 5.打开浏览器调试工具,发现报以下错误...
可以的,如果还没有域名,你可以在后端指定前端的 IP 地址和端口号来允许跨域请求并携带 Cookies。Access-Control-Allow-Origin 头可以设置为前端运行的 IP 地址加端口号,这样跨域请求就能正常进行。示例:指定 IP + 端口号 假设你的前端在本地运行,IP 是 192.168.1.100,端口号是 8080,你可以在后端 CORS ...
"Access-Control-Allow-Origin"是一个HTTP响应头,用于指定允许访问该资源的域名。当浏览器发起跨域请求时,服务器需要在响应头中添加"Access-Control-Allow-Origin"头部,指定允许访问的域名。 解决"Access-Control-Allow-Origin"错误的方法有以下几种: 在服务器端设置响应头:在服务器端配置响应头,添加"Access-Co...